    The 5 Pillars of Health Every Entrepreneur Needs to Succeed

    In this episode, Chris Papin engages in a deep conversation with Dr. Castel Santana, exploring the intersection of health, wellness, and business. Dr. Santana shares his five pillars of health, emphasizing the importance of a holistic approach to wellness that includes medical, physical, mental, spiritual, and aesthetic aspects. The discussion highlights the challenges individuals face in maintaining their health amidst busy lives and the necessity of intentionality in self-care. Dr. Santana draws parallels between athletic discipline and health management, advocating for a mindset shift that prioritizes personal well-being as a foundation for success in business and life. The conversation concludes with insights on the power of gratitude and the importance of planning and communication in both health and business endeavors. About the Guest Dr. Castel Santana, MD/CFMP, known to his patients as Dr. Cas, is a board-certified family medicine doctor and Certified Functional Medicine Practitioner. During his career, he has seen the power of healthy, happy communities and has dedicated his career to creating that – one patient at a time.  After graduating residency, Dr. Cas began delivering his unique model of health care to patients, blending the best of integrative and functional medicine that focuses on whole body wellness and finding each individual’s pathway to optimal living. He also completed the requirements to become a Certified Functional Medicine Practitioner. He has owned two successful practices over the last 10 years servicing more than 10,000 patients and now the Medical Director for 10X Health, which is a National brand that holds an evaluation of over 1 billion dollars.     Navigating Change in Entrepreneurship

    In this episode of the BLABO Podcast, host Chris Papin and guest Jedidiah Kinderknecht discuss the multifaceted nature of entrepreneurship, emphasizing the importance of mindset, financial foundations, and the role of advisory relationships. They explore the challenges business owners face in navigating change, the significance of intentionality in decision-making, and the value of community and relationships. The conversation highlights the necessity of having a clear vision and purpose, adapting to challenges, and finding a balance between work and life. Ultimately, they stress the importance of surrounding oneself with supportive individuals who can provide honest feedback and guidance. About the Guest Jedidiah Kinderknecht is the Founder and President of a CPA Inc., a boutique firm in Dublin, Ohio, specializing in tax and accounting services for small businesses. With over a decade of experience and a team of six professionals, Jedidiah is known for his strategic mindset, tech-forward approach, and commitment to helping business owners behave like business owners—making smart financial decisions that drive long-term success. Outside of work, Jedidiah is a devoted husband and father, balancing the demands of entrepreneurship with family life. He’s passionate about creating a business that supports both his clients and his personal values.     Balancing Act: Working On And In Your Business

    In this episode of the BLABO Podcast, Chris Papin and Mark Martukovich discuss the mindset required for successful business ownership. They explore the balance between working on and in a business, the transition from transactional to advisory services, and the importance of delegation and trust. Mark shares insights on hiring for business acumen, the role of AI in business, and how to value advisory services. The conversation emphasizes building strong relationships with clients and treating a business as an investment rather than just a paycheck. About the Guest Mark Martukovich is a Certified Public Accountant and Managing Partner of Business Advisory and Accounting Partners (BAAP), a firm known for turning accounting from an expense into a strategic investment. With over 25 years of business development and consulting experience — and a career that spans public accounting, corporate leadership, and commercial banking — Mark brings a board-level advisory perspective to every client relationship. Mark began his career in 1989 as a staff accountant in Cleveland, Ohio, after graduating from The University of Akron with a degree in accounting. His early work in public accounting was followed by senior leadership roles in business development, where he helped organizations scale, implement technology solutions, and open new markets. In 2004, Mark transitioned into commercial banking, spending a decade advising small and mid-sized companies in the Tampa Bay area.  Since joining BAAP in 2010, Mark has been the driving force behind the firm’s business advisory consulting model, which combines: Tax efficiency strategies designed around each client’s long-term goals.Operational and financial analysis to improve profitability and resilience.Succession and exit planning that helps owners turn their business into a true retirement asset.Mark is a recognized leader in the accounting profession. He serves as a featured speaker for Thomson Reuters’ Partner Summit: Moving Your Practice Forward, where he trains other CPAs on transitioning from compliance-focused work to becoming proactive business advisors. He also served on the Board of Directors of the SPCA Tampa Bay from November 2019 until January 2025, reflecting his commitment to community leadership.     The Psychology Behind Successful Business Deals

    In this episode of the BLABO Podcast, host Chris Papin and guest Melissa Gragg discuss the intricacies of business valuation, negotiation, and the importance of mindset in business ownership. They explore the significance of starting with the end in mind, the role of cash flow in determining business value, and the psychological aspects of negotiation. The conversation also highlights the necessity of accurate financial reporting, the impact of deal fatigue, and the importance of preparing for due diligence when selling a business. Melissa shares valuable insights and strategies for business owners looking to navigate the complexities of selling their businesses and achieving successful outcomes. About Melissa Gragg Melissa Gragg is a financial mediator, business valuation expert, and trusted guide for individuals navigating high-stakes financial decisions — especially during divorce. With more than two decades of experience in business valuation, litigation support, and collaborative dispute resolution, Melissa helps couples and business owners replace conflict with clarity. She specializes in creating fair, data-driven settlement offers, untangling complex assets, and making financial disclosures easy to understand. As the founder of ValuationMediation.com and The Divorce Allies, Melissa empowers clients to negotiate from a position of strength, avoid unnecessary litigation, and walk away with a plan for lasting financial stability.
